Home
last modified time | relevance | path

Searched refs:VisibilityMacroDirective (Results 1 – 7 of 7) sorted by relevance

/NextBSD/contrib/llvm/tools/clang/lib/Lex/
HDMacroInfo.cpp186 VisibilityMacroDirective *VisMD = cast<VisibilityMacroDirective>(MD); in getDefinition()
222 if (isa<VisibilityMacroDirective>(this)) in dump()
HDPPLexerChange.cpp718 if (auto *VisMD = dyn_cast<VisibilityMacroDirective>(MD)) { in LeaveSubmodule()
HDPPDirectives.cpp75 VisibilityMacroDirective *
78 return new (BP) VisibilityMacroDirective(Loc, isPublic); in AllocateVisibilityMacroDirective()
HDPPMacroExpansion.cpp171 while (MD && isa<VisibilityMacroDirective>(MD)) in updateModuleMacroInfo()
/NextBSD/contrib/llvm/tools/clang/include/clang/Lex/
HDMacroInfo.h455 class VisibilityMacroDirective : public MacroDirective {
457 explicit VisibilityMacroDirective(SourceLocation Loc, bool Public) in VisibilityMacroDirective() function
469 static bool classof(const VisibilityMacroDirective *) { return true; } in classof() argument
HDPreprocessor.h811 while (MD && isa<VisibilityMacroDirective>(MD)) in getMacroDefinition()
1691 VisibilityMacroDirective *AllocateVisibilityMacroDirective(SourceLocation Loc,
/NextBSD/contrib/llvm/tools/clang/lib/Serialization/
HDASTWriter.cpp2065 } else if (auto *VisMD = dyn_cast<VisibilityMacroDirective>(MD)) { in WritePreprocessor()